We also describe how drinking alcohol can interfere with weight loss.A 1.5-ounce serving of plain, 80-proof (40 percent) vodka contains.Standard, plain vodka only contains water and alcohol (ethanol), aside from trace amounts of impurities and nutrients.All of the calories in vodka, therefore, come from the alcohol.As the concentration of alcohol in vodka increases, so does the calorie count.The percentage of alcohol in this type of liquor is called the proof.
